SODELPA present views on Budget

June 7, 2019 5:30 am

As the nation awaits the 2019 and 2020 budget announcement, the Social Democratic Liberal Party has given their views on what might be the outcome of the National Budget announcement.

The Party leader Sitiveni Rabuka and other senior members of SODELPA gave their observation saying the budget could be impacted by the global economic uncertainty.

Already asserting their opinion on the outcome of the budget, Rabuka says government needs to re-look at how assistance are distributed.

“There is too much non targeted assistance in this sectors therefore the focus should be identifying those who really need the assistance and be given the support, rather than the current arrangement where any Tom, Dick and Frank can get assistance”

With government trying to introduce sound economic policies to try and create a sustainable economy, Rabuka is calling on government to reduce consumption.

“We must try and maintain our current revenue trend which is already quite high as the percentage of GDP and reduce wastage.”

SODELPA MP Aseri Radrodro says a tax review is needed so that people are not overtaxed.

The party is calling on government to urgently improve the way it manages the economy given the insecurity of trade negotiations between top world countries.
